    What is Capcom vs. SNK: Millennium Fight 2000?

    Capcom vs. SNK: Millennium Fight 2000 is a legendary 2D fighting game that brings together iconic characters from Capcom's Street Fighter series and SNK's King of Fighters/Fatal Fury universes. Released in arcades and later ported to PlayStation, this crossover masterpiece features intense tag-team battles, unique ratio systems for team building, and beautifully animated sprites. Players experience dream matchups like Ryu vs. Kyo Kusanagi while exploring distinct fighting styles through Capcom's six-button layout and SNK's four-button mechanics.

    Game Features

    • Epic Character Roster: Choose from 33 fighters including Ryu, Ken, Terry Bogard, Mai Shiranui, and Iori Yagami
    • Ratio System: Assign power levels (1-3) to create balanced 3-character teams
    • Two Fighting Styles: Select between Capcom's EX Mode (focus on super combos) or SNK's Advanced/Groove Mode (emphasis on dodges and counters)
    • Dynamic Tag Battles: Switch between team members mid-fight for strategic combos
    • Stunning Visuals: Signature anime-inspired sprites with vibrant special effects
    • Diverse Stages: Battle across 17 dynamic arenas with interactive elements

    Frequently Asked Questions

    What makes this different from other fighting games?
    The unique Ratio System forces strategic team-building decisions, while the dual fighting styles (Capcom EX vs. SNK Groove) create fundamentally different gameplay experiences within the same match.

    Can I play as single characters or only teams?
    You can assemble teams of 1-3 fighters using the Ratio System. Single-character "Ratio 3" selections are viable but face stronger opponents.

    Are there any secret characters?
    Yes! Complete specific conditions to unlock hidden fighters like Shin Akuma and God Rugal, who possess devastating special moves and altered stats.
